Ballinrees is a townland in County Londonderry, Northern Ireland, situated within a region characterized by its diverse landscapes. The area features the dramatic cliffs of Binevenagh Mountain, part of the Binevenagh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, alongside serene forest trails in Springwell Forest and the Ballinrees Reservoir. This varied terrain provides opportunities for several sports like road cycling, mountain biking, touring cycling, jogging, and more, making Ballinrees a notable destination for outdoor pursuits.

The Ballinrees area is known for its diverse natural features, including the dramatic cliffs of Binevenagh Mountain and the serene Ballinrees Reservoir within Springwell Forest. Coastal beauty, such as Castlerock Beach and Mussenden Temple, is also nearby. These features contribute to the region's scenic outdoor experiences.
